Nettet15. feb. 2024 · Lime wash is fundamentally made from naturally occurring limestone that has been crushed, burned and then mixed with water to create a putty. This putty is then traditionally aged and then thinned with water. Some limewash can …

Nettet19. des. 2024 · Using a 5-inch box brush, start at the top corner of your wall and work your way down, cutting in as you go. Use a crisscross X pattern to create a natural texture; don’t go over the same spot twice. Let it dry completely—don’t panic at the initial color, as limewash looks darker when it’s wet. Nettet30. nov. 2024 · Step 1- prepare your wall. Limewash needs to be applied onto a porous surface for it to adhere properly. Traditional limewash was done on brick or stone walls. If you’re not working with that, and instead working with an interior drywall wall with a layer of wall paint already on top, you’ll need to prime your wall. Nettet10. feb. 2024 · Cover the walls with an acrylic-based primer; this will help the lime wash adhere to the surface and prevent peeling and cracking. Following the manufacturer’s instructions, prepare the lime wash. Using a long-haired brush, apply the wash onto the wall using crisscross strokes, and keep a wet edge as you work.

Nettet2. nov. 2024 · Lime wash is a versatile paint and can be used within the home, or outside of it. In contrast to other typical house paints that sit atop the surface of the walls, lime wash absorbs into the surface. It is best to apply lime wash to porous surfaces such as plaster, stone, and masonry.
